Why the Fastener Matters

Cement backer boards, like HardieBacker or Durock, are heavy, rigid, and moisture-resistant. But they demand fasteners that can penetrate dense material without rusting, breaking, or backing out over time. The wrong fastener can corrode, snap, or allow board movement, compromising the tile system laid on top.

In high-humidity applications—showers, kitchens, pool rooms, or exterior façades—the fastener is the first line of defense against moisture intrusion, substrate shifting, and tile delamination.

1. For Interior Wet Walls and Showers: Use Alkali-Resistant Coated Screws

For residential and commercial interior wet zones, go with corrosion-resistant screws specifically designed for cement board. These often feature a special alkali-resistant coating and hi-lo threads that drive smoothly without damaging the board.

Benefits:

Prevents rusting in moist conditions

Tapered bugle head avoids “mushrooming” of board surface

Sharp points for easy start without pre-drilling

Use Case Tip: For Canadian bathrooms or locker rooms with high humidity, coated backer board screws (e.g., polymer-coated steel) meet both performance and code expectations.

2. For Floor Underlayment Systems: Recommend Self-Drilling Cement Board Screws

Installing cement board over plywood or OSB subfloors requires fasteners that grip both materials firmly. Self-drilling cement board screws with ribbed countersinking heads ensure flush installation without tile “pop.”

Features:

Dual threads prevent board movement during install

Self-drilling tip eliminates need for pre-drilling

Designed to reduce squeaking under foot traffic

Best For: Multi-family housing, retail flooring retrofits, hotel bathroom floors

3. For Exterior Applications: Use Stainless Steel Fasteners

When cement board is installed as part of an exterior façade or rainscreen system, only stainless steel fasteners provide the corrosion resistance needed to survive Canadian freeze-thaw cycles and driving rain.

Why It’s Critical:

Galvanized fasteners can eventually corrode in freeze/thaw environments

Stainless steel won’t react with cement or salt

Required in coastal or northern climates with prolonged moisture exposure

Compliance Note: Always confirm fastener type with local code requirements and with backer board manufacturer specifications.

4. For Fire-Rated Assemblies: Select Code-Compliant Collated Screws

In hospitals, schools, and multi-residential projects, fire-rated walls often include cement backer board as part of the assembly. Fasteners in these assemblies must meet fire code and installation speed demands.

Recommended: Collated, corrosion-resistant screws compatible with auto-feed drivers

Benefits:

Speeds up installation on commercial jobsites

Ensures uniform depth and spacing

Meets ASTM C1002 or equivalent standards for wall assemblies

Don’t Use These

Drywall screws: They’re too brittle for cement board and corrode quickly

Standard wood screws: Poor holding power and inadequate coating

Nails: Prone to backing out and don’t hold up in high-humidity applications

Installation Insights for Field Teams

Spacing: Follow manufacturer guidelines—typically 8” on center for walls, 6” for floors

Depth: Ensure screw heads are flush—not overdriven or proud

Edge Clearance: Keep fasteners at least 3/8” from board edges to avoid cracking

Tools: Use impact drivers with depth control or auto-feed drivers for commercial installs

What Buyers Should Ask Before Ordering Fasteners

Is the backer board being installed in a wet or dry area?

Will it be used on floors, walls, or exterior façades?

Are there fire rating or corrosion resistance requirements?

Is speed of install (manual vs. collated) a factor for this project?

The Bottom Line: Treat Fasteners as a System Component

Fasteners for cementitious backer board aren’t just accessories—they’re part of a system. From polymer-coated screws in showers to stainless fasteners on exterior envelopes, the right choice prevents costly failures down the line.
